Output 8366fa5fb7754412651e34d5411ff228ab85bdae762af8b590ab701a1d41b5b1:121

value
500000
script pubkey
OP_0 OP_PUSHBYTES_20 3d960a7e78fd6b4a400038b6a63424c5c5bec3e6
address
bc1q8ktq5lncl4455sqq8zm2vdpychzmaslx4dn30t
transaction
8366fa5fb7754412651e34d5411ff228ab85bdae762af8b590ab701a1d41b5b1